Mayor Britain reported that Kauffman-Smith-Emert Investment Co,
had declined to acceed to proposal that the Interest and Principal
of the issue of $40.000.00 Street Improvement Bonds be made pay- o
able at the office of the City Treasurer of the City of Wichita 9'
Falls, whereupon motion was made by J L Lea, Jr and sec�ned by ppo
J A Richolt, that the offer of The International Trust Co, of
Denver, Colo, be accepted provedkthey at once file with bid , .p0$'
Certified Check on some bank of the City of Wichita Falls and
that Mayor Britain be authorized to wire them accrdingly at once.
Motion carried.

Bids were opened for the deposits of the cityr.s funds for the
next year as follows;
The City National Bank bid 2 7/8% on daily balances.
The National Bank of Commerce made a bid of 3% on
daily balnces, whereupon motion was made by J F Reed and seconded
by M J Gradner that the bid of the NationeBank of Commerce bf 30
on daily balances be accepted, and that the Natihal Bank aF
Comme;;ce�`hppoirted the depository of the city's 'funds for the
ensue'ing one year upon the execution and filing af,an exceptable
bond of Two hundred Thousand ($2000000.00) Bailers.: -,.
Motion carried.
Messers Gardner and Richolt reported that they had conferred with
the County Commissioners with reference to the removal of the
watering tank out of Lamar Ise, and an agreement had been reached
whereby the County had ageme¢ to bear one hlaf of the expense of
?!' � the removal and the installing of ac.onerete wai i trough within
the curb on 7th street between Lamar Ave and the entrance to
court house yard.
